Deal Details
secondpity via eBay has Sony WF-1000XM4 Noise Canceling Wireless Earbuds (Refurbished) for $127.49 when you apply code REFURB15 at checkout. Shipping is free. Slickdeals Cashback is available for this store (PC extension required, before checkout).

Thanks to Community Members kebins.jpg for finding this deal.

AvailableCondition:
  • "This item has been refurbished by the manufacturer or an approved refurbisher. The product functions like new and shows minimal if any, signs of wear. All standard accessories included. Items will be placed in non-retail packaging to better safeguard their condition. Manuals and other documentation can be found on the manufacturer's support site

Quote from srikvp View quoted comment :
Beware that some of these buds have a "ringing" issue while listening to audiobooks or calls. This is not noticeable while listening to music and can only be heard during the above use cases.

If you get a good pair, these are the best ANC IEMs in the market right now and are well worth the price.
I also bought these refurbed and they have the ringing issue. When it is purely listening to anything with speech, it's actually headache inducing. I'm trying to justify keeping it since the ANC is so good.
